Rancho Sisquoc Winery, located at Address: 6600 Foxen Canyon Rd, Santa Maria, CA 93454, United States, is a hidden gem off the beaten track of Foxen Canyon Road. This establishment is a winery, gift shop, picnic ground, and vineyard, offering a variety of on-site services such as delivery, wheelchair-accessible facilities, and multiple payment options, including debit cards, mobile wallets, and credit cards.

Characteristics and Ubication

The winery boasts a beautiful venue and friendly staff. Some visitors describe it as their favorite winery ever, with a wide selection of delicious wines. Among the top recommendations is the Pinot Noir. The grounds are breathtaking, making it an ideal spot for a picnic or a relaxing day while wine tasting in the area.

Information and Recommendations

Rancho Sisquoc Winery offers a good selection of wines, with plenty of open space to enjoy the warm Santa Barbara County. It is recommended to bring a picnic and enjoy a bottle or a glass of their wines. The location might be challenging to find, so it is advisable to plan the route ahead of time.

Been visiting Rancho Sisquoc Winery for over 40 years. Hidden gem north of the Santa Ynez Valley, a bit off the grid, so seldom crowded. Excellent wine tasting room & excellent wine selection, welcoming picnic area, clean bathrooms, super friendly staff. Thank you to the Flood family & descendents for maintaining this homey facility, reminiscent of the wine tasting spots of the old days.
